Condividi tramite


GLKTextureLoader.BeginLoadCubeMapAsync Metodo

Definizione

Overload

BeginLoadCubeMapAsync(NSUrl, NSDictionary, DispatchQueue)

Carica in modo asincrono una mappa del cubo.

BeginLoadCubeMapAsync(String, NSDictionary, DispatchQueue)

Carica in modo asincrono una mappa del cubo.

BeginLoadCubeMapAsync(NSUrl, NSDictionary, DispatchQueue)

Carica in modo asincrono una mappa del cubo.

public virtual System.Threading.Tasks.Task<GLKit.GLKTextureInfo> BeginLoadCubeMapAsync (Foundation.NSUrl filePath, Foundation.NSDictionary textureOperations, CoreFoundation.DispatchQueue queue);
abstract member BeginLoadCubeMapAsync : Foundation.NSUrl * Foundation.NSDictionary * CoreFoundation.DispatchQueue -> System.Threading.Tasks.Task<GLKit.GLKTextureInfo>
override this.BeginLoadCubeMapAsync : Foundation.NSUrl * Foundation.NSDictionary * CoreFoundation.DispatchQueue -> System.Threading.Tasks.Task<GLKit.GLKTextureInfo>

Parametri

filePath
NSUrl

File contenente la trama.

textureOperations
NSDictionary

NSDictionary popolato con opzioni di configurazione. In alternativa, usare la versione fortemente tipizzata di questo metodo che accetta un oggetto GLKTextureOperations. Questo parametro può essere .

queue
DispatchQueue

Coda in cui verrà richiamato il metodo callback o null per richiamare il metodo nella coda di invio principale. Questo parametro può essere .

Restituisce

Attività che rappresenta l'operazione BeginLoadCubeMap asincrona. Il valore del parametro TResult è un GLKTextureLoaderCallbackoggetto .

Si applica a

BeginLoadCubeMapAsync(String, NSDictionary, DispatchQueue)

Carica in modo asincrono una mappa del cubo.

public virtual System.Threading.Tasks.Task<GLKit.GLKTextureInfo> BeginLoadCubeMapAsync (string fileName, Foundation.NSDictionary textureOperations, CoreFoundation.DispatchQueue queue);
abstract member BeginLoadCubeMapAsync : string * Foundation.NSDictionary * CoreFoundation.DispatchQueue -> System.Threading.Tasks.Task<GLKit.GLKTextureInfo>
override this.BeginLoadCubeMapAsync : string * Foundation.NSDictionary * CoreFoundation.DispatchQueue -> System.Threading.Tasks.Task<GLKit.GLKTextureInfo>

Parametri

fileName
String

Nome file da cui verranno caricati i dati.

textureOperations
NSDictionary

NSDictionary popolato con opzioni di configurazione. In alternativa, usare la versione fortemente tipizzata di questo metodo che accetta un oggetto GLKTextureOperations. Questo parametro può essere .

queue
DispatchQueue

Coda in cui verrà richiamato il metodo callback o null per richiamare il metodo nella coda di invio principale. Questo parametro può essere .

Restituisce

Attività che rappresenta l'operazione BeginLoadCubeMap asincrona. Il valore del parametro TResult è un GLKTextureLoaderCallbackoggetto .

Si applica a